Record ID: NLM-7F03F3
Object type: VESSEL
Broad period: EARLY MEDIEVAL
County: Lincolnshire
Workflow stage: Published Find published
A fragment from a copper-alloy sheet Anglo-Saxon mount, probably from a bucket. The incomplete fragment is now U-shaped and tapers in width to the arms. There are the remains of a rivet hole on one of the arms. The fragment is decorated with a border on both edges of punched triangles and circles. The length is 30.0mm, the width is 31.6mm, the thickness is 1.5mm and the weight is 4.08g.

Record ID: NLM-7D4337
Object type: STRAP END
Broad period: EARLY MEDIEVAL
County: Lincolnshire
Workflow stage: Published Find published
An incomplete early-medieval cast lead strap end. The tongue shaped strap end is rendered in Winchester style. Although some damage has occurred to the decoration, the symmetrical ornament of a central stem of an acanthus plant with scroll branches is still visible. The length is 26.8mm, the width is 22.7mm and the weight is 12.57g.

Record ID: NLM-7D22C5
Object type: SLEEVE CLASP
Broad period: EARLY MEDIEVAL
County: Lincolnshire
Workflow stage: Awaiting validation Find awaiting validation
An incomplete cast copper-alloy Anglo-Saxon sleeve clasp. The hook-piece and probably belongs to Hines B18c. The sub-rectangular bar has a row of conjoined knobs along the rear edge with an attachment hole in between each knob. The bar is divded into rectangular panels divded by a worn transverse rib under each attachment hole. The clasp has broken off just after the integral rectangular hook. The surviving length is 24.0mm, the width is 12.2mm and the weight is 2.36g.

Record ID: NLM-D5DCF6
Object type: STRAP END
Broad period: EARLY MEDIEVAL
County: Lincolnshire
Workflow stage: Awaiting validation Find awaiting validation
Possibly an incomplete copper-alloy strap end of Thomas' Class E, Type 4. The two piece tongue-shaped strap end is broken around all the edges. In between the two sheets is a lead core. One face of the strap end is decorated with Borre style with symmetrical segmented interlacing plaits that probably formed part of an animal body. The surviving length is 24.4mm, the width is 26.2mm, the thickness is 2.8mm and the weight is 5.09g.

Record ID: NLM-D53EB4
Object type: SLEEVE CLASP
Broad period: EARLY MEDIEVAL
County: Lincolnshire
Workflow stage: Awaiting validation Find awaiting validation
An incomplete cast copper-alloy Anglo-Saxon sleeve clasp of Hines's Class C, Miscellaneous form. The slightly convex T-shaped hook piece has one arm missing and is worn around the edges. The outer edge of the integral rectangular hook is also missing. The clasp is decorated with zoomorphic ornament with traces if gilding still remaining. The surviving length is 28.0mm, the width is 19.9mm and the weight is 3.66g. Compare Hines (1993) fig. 142, from Morningthorpe grave 360, and examples on the PAS database at YORYM-07B0E3 and NMS-740954.

Record ID: NLM-861E47
Object type: BROOCH
Broad period: EARLY MEDIEVAL
County: Lincolnshire
Workflow stage: Published Find published
Fragment of a circular lead brooch, very worn. triangular geometic pattern around the outer edge with a circular wave pattern inside the inner circle of the brooch. dimensions: 29.1mm, width 17.2mm thickness 2mm, weight 4.17g. This brooch was allocated by Rosie Weetch to Type 32, unknown/other plate brooch, but from the drawing it seems as if it must be a Type 13, the stepped type. These date to the 11th century.

Record ID: NLM-013882
Object type: BROOCH
Broad period: EARLY MEDIEVAL
County: North Lincolnshire
Workflow stage: Published Find published
A fragment from a cast copper-alloy Anglo-Saxon jewelled disc brooch. The surviving quarter panel of the flat circular brooch is decorated with a gilded Style II animal design. The interlacing animal has horizontal ribs on the ribbon-like body. His snake-like head is on the top right of the panel though it is now quite worn. On either side of the decorated panel is an incomplete plain field with an empty circular setting near the outer edge of the brooch.
